自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

空中花园的专栏

人在技术江湖---人得自个儿成全自个儿-----lingtu-sysnet-isoftstone

  • 博客(90)
  • 收藏
  • 关注

原创 oracle日期常用函数记录_user

1、LAST_DAY(d) 获得当月最后一天 select sysdate,LAST_DAY(sysdate) LAST_DAY from dual; // select sysdate,LAST_DAY(sysdate)+1 LAST_DAY from dual;//走到下一月2、ADD_MONTHS(d,n) 时间点d再加上n个月 select sys...

2010-11-15 17:59:42 199

原创 多线程_并发访问_锁机制_servelt

----------------------------------------------------------------------------------------------------------------2010-11-11 struts1 的前端控制器是单例的,线程不安全的;每次请求都会用同一actionServlet; struts2 的acti...

2010-11-11 18:24:01 153

原创 理解单点登录CAS

SSO的实现机制不尽相同,大体分为Cookie机制和Session机制 Weblogic通过Session共享认证信息。Session是一种服务器端机制,但客户端访问服务器时,服务器为客户端创建一个唯一的SessionId,以使在整个交互工程中始终保持状态,而交互的信息则可由应用自行指定,因此用Session方式实现SSO,不能在多个浏览器之间实现单点登录,但可以跨域...

2010-11-08 18:10:59 174

原创 关闭浏览器&会话session关闭——关系

但第一次访问一个站点的时候,网站服务器会在响应头内加上Set-Cookie:PHPSESSID=.....(php服务器),或Set-Cookie JSESSIONID=....(java服务器)信息,此信息是服务器随机生成的,放在服务器内存里,为了标识唯一的客户端用户,内容不会重复,这就是sessionId. 但浏览器得到这个sessionId,会将它放在自己的进程内...

2010-11-08 16:50:15 635

原创 唯有创新才能打败巨头

互联网有个特点:不垄断就会死。 大家都很烦百度、腾讯,因为他们"垄断"。 但是,不管喜不喜欢,垄断是无法避免的,寡头化是互联网产品运营的必然特征。 传统的产品,厂家卖给你,你拿回家用,跟别的产品别的用户不会发生什么关系,所以,你选择这款产品那款产品都可以,一个市场上肯定存在多款同质化的产品。但互联网产品,运行商只搭了个框架,里面的数据、关系,都是拥护产生的,也...

2010-11-08 15:03:13 113

原创 Spring MVC_HandlerInterceptorAdapter的使用

一般情况下,对来自浏览器的请求的拦截,是利用Filter实现的,这种方式可以实现Bean预处理、后处理。 Spring MVC的拦截器不仅可实现Filter的所有功能,还可以更精确的控制拦截精度。 Spring为我们提供了org.springframework.web.servlet.handler.HandlerInterceptorAdapter这个适配器,继承此类,可以非常方便的实现...

2010-11-08 11:35:07 86

原创 每天坚持比别人多训练一个小时

《哪里来的天才-练习中的平凡和伟大》这本书其实观点很简单。  这个世界上没有天才,任何天才在成功之前都经过了至少7年的艰苦而专注的刻意训练。  那你怎么解释莫扎特?他不是四岁就谱写的钢琴曲吗?  这本书给我留下最深印象的就是这个故事,莫扎特的确有天赋,但是,他的第一首钢琴曲更多是父亲的策划,不全是他自己的天赋,他真正成为一名被认可的作曲家,已经是他经...

2010-09-12 21:01:19 234

原创 GAE ing

1、GAE java开源框架支持列表http://groups.google.com/group/google-appengine-java/web/will-it-play-in-app-engine

2010-09-08 14:08:53 120

原创 一些编程事实

我的程序员经历让我明白了一些关于软件开发的事情。下面是一些在编程中可能会让人感到诧异的事情:一个程序员用了大约只用了10%-20%的时间来编码,而且大多数程序员,无论他的水平如何,其平均每天只有10-12行的代码最终会进入最终的软件产品中。这是因为,优秀的程序员会花费90%的时间来思考、调查、研究最佳的设计。而糟糕的程序员则会花费90%的时间来调试代码,并随意地改动代码并尝试让代码工作起来...

2010-09-05 21:17:22 95

原创 学习技术的几个境界

治学三境界:第一:昨夜西风凋碧树,独上高楼,望断天涯路。(蝶恋花 - 晏殊)第二:衣带渐宽终不悔,为伊消得人憔悴。(凤栖梧 - 柳永)第三:众里寻他千百度,蓦然回首,那人却在,灯火阑姗处。(青玉案 - 辛弃疾) ...

2010-07-26 15:13:03 122

原创 几种开源Java Web容器线程池的实现方法简介——Tomcat(一)

目前市场上常用的开源Java Web容器有Tomcat、Resin和Jetty。其中Resin从V3.0后需要购买才能用于商业目的,而其他两种则是纯开源的。可以分别从他们的网站上下载最新的二进制包和源代码。 作为Web容器,需要承受较高的访问量,能够同时响应不同用户的请求,能够在恶劣环境下保持较高的稳定性和健壮性。在HTTP服务器领域,Apache HTTPD的效率是最高的...

2010-06-07 11:27:46 176

Criteria的用法

Criteria Query通过面向对象化的设计,将数据查询条件封装为一个对象。简单来讲,Criteria Query可以看作是传统SQL的对象化表示,如: Java代码 Criteria criteria = session.createCriteria(User.class); criteria.add(Expression.eq("name","Erica"));...

2010-04-30 10:54:09 337

来北京四周年纪念日

2009.07.18是我来北京的四周年纪念日。05年的这一天,什么都没有想,义无反顾地来了。来了之后才知道,单位这么差,薪水这么低,住房这么难,人生地不熟。但那个时候,也没想着退缩,来就来了,反正饿不死,待待看吧。这一待,转眼四年过去了。============================================================从前光滑的...

2009-07-17 10:49:23 130

parent.window.location.href 和 iframe中src的乱码问题

parent.window.location.href 和 iframe中src的乱码问题。要在这两个url地址中传中文,必须加编码,然后再解码。编码:encodeURI(encodeURI("包含中文的串"))解码:java.net.URLDecoder.decode("需要解码的串","utf-8");----------这只是其中一种处理方法。...

2009-06-15 15:44:52 291

parent.window.location.href 和 iframe中src的乱码问题

parent.window.location.href 和 iframe中src的乱码问题。要在这两个url地址中传中文,必须加编码,然后再解码。编码:encodeURI(encodeURI("包含中文的串"))解码:java.net.URLDecoder.decode("需要解码的串","utf-8");...

2009-06-15 15:43:52 320

原创 jndi调用时,各种应用服务器InitialContext的写法

jndi调用时,各种应用服务器InitialContext的写法 调用ejb时,如果客户端和ejb不在同一个jvm,就要设置InitialContext,不同的应用服务器InitialContext写法也不同.Context.INITIAL_CONTEXT_FACTORY:指定到目录服务的连接工厂Context.PROVIDER_URL:目录服务提供者URL//jboss:...

2009-03-25 11:56:23 257

原创 url 传递参数(特殊字符)解决方法

url 传递参数(特殊字符)解决方法 首先设置 apache 配置文件, server.xml 在 port=8080 那一行中加上 URIEcoding=GBK 有些符号在URL中是不能直接传递的,如果要在URL中传递这些特殊符号,那么就要使用他们的编码了。下表中列出了一些URL特殊符号及编码      十六进制值 1. + URL 中+号表示空格 %2B 2...

2009-03-24 10:42:48 374

Java web应用 和Java enterprise应用的区别

web应用是属于enterprise应用的一部分 enterprise应用可以包括web应用,jms应用,ejb应用,连接器应用等等 enterprise应用一般都需要application server来支持,需要有其它更多的容器,比如weblogic中有ejb容器,JMS容器;websphere中有MQ容器;但web应用只需要有一个web container就可以,一般的ap...

2009-03-16 11:20:29 1174

原创 如何做好开发团队负责人---管别人先管好自已,请从做一名合格程序员开始

【转】如何做好开发团队负责人---管别人先管好自已,请从做一名合格程序员开始 开发经理(开发组长)开发经理是团队中的大师那就该是整个团队工作中的榜样,无论是工作效率、态度、分析设计水平、业务知识、技术能力各方面都要努力让自己成为团队成员榜样。 开发经理除了安排好目前工作之外还需要主动学习,不断提高自己的业务和技术水平。很多人会说很忙没有时间,那就要求开发经理要...

2009-03-06 17:07:42 198

原创 新学一招, 判断一个js对象是不是数组

从大城小胖的大城【永久域名 http://fins.iteye.com】处转帖: 从http://blog.360.yahoo.com/blog-TBPekxc1dLNy5DOloPfzVvFIVOWMB0li?p=916学来一招, 判断一个js对象是不是数组Java代码[quote] 1. function isArray(o) { 2. ...

2009-01-13 18:08:21 86

原创 你的时间在那里,成就就在那里

40岁以前,大部份的人是相同的,升学读书升学读书……,建立自己基础。在父母亲友,社会价值观影响及误打误撞的情况下完成基本教育。 选择读书,应该一鼓作气,在您尚未进入产业时,能读多高就多高,毕竟何时进 入产业,您都是社会新鲜人。 但是一旦您已经有工作经验而又有心进修,当然管道很多,相对的挣扎也多。因为您不知现在的年纪、条件、资历……再去做进修这样的投资是否值得?如...

2009-01-04 11:46:02 72

原创 成功最大的秘诀就是坚持!

成功最大的秘诀就是坚持! 在学习上,不管你的学习方法是什么,也不论你有多聪明,如果你想获得真正的成功,你必须坚持操练。 你必须每天利用每分钟空闲的时间不断操练。 你必须一遍一遍地重复同一个句子,直到你可以自然而然地脱口而出。 你必须强迫你自己不停地练习,不停地努力,不停地奋斗来提高。 永远没有一个时候你可以真正说出:“...

2008-12-22 14:07:13 136

原创 程序员成长最快的环境--引用江南白衣

程序员成长最快的环境 ----作者:江南白衣 除开五大或者ThoughtWorks这种要什么有什么,进去做打字也能光耀门楣的不谈。如果是嫁到一个普通软件公司,怎样的环境才能最快的成长呢? 首先基本的公司项目管理水平是必要的;其次是稳健而不保守的公司技术选型和一班能沟通的同事。 更重要的,是要有一个严苛的环境,那些古训说的都没错,越是严...

2008-08-27 14:49:12 110

原创 MyEclipse6.5使用设置技巧

MyEclipse6.5使用设置技巧在网上找了些资料.整理了下...借SpringSide3.0正式发布之际.贴出来.希望能给各位方便的开发体验! 在MyEclipse6.0甚至更高的6.5GA版本中的快捷键中把我们习惯性使用的Alt+/进行代码自动补齐 但是由于于之前版本有快捷键有冲突,所以总之不能自动提示 以下是解决方法 方法如下: 1...

2008-08-27 13:50:05 115

在MyEclipse6.5中配置配置数据库连接,出错

用MyEclipse6.5,打开Hibernate透视图,打开"DB Broswer"配置数据库连接,new 一个连接。 在所有的驱动名、url、用户名、密码、驱动jar包填上以后,Test时,不成功报错。如下:"invalid or unknown nls parameter value hibernate"或是: while trying to lo...

2008-08-12 17:47:11 209

MyEclipse6.0-MyEclipse6.5-Eclipse(WTP)

wtp的server view 和 MyEclipse的server view 是不一样的。比如: 在服务器用tomcat时 1、用MyEclipse6.0之类的先建工程,关闭MyEclipse; 2、然后用WTP来打开workSpace,打开server view,关闭WTP; 3、再用MyEclipse打开工程,这样,就能看到wtp下的se...

2008-07-11 13:55:49 76

MyEclipse6.5已经在使用中了

MyEclipse6.5的VSS插件也要用:vssplugin_1.6.2;【超人。。。。。。。】

2008-07-11 13:46:04 71

SQLserver中用convert函数转换日期格式

SQLserver中用convert函数转换日期格式:select getdate()结果:2003-12-28 16:52:00.107select convert(char(8),getdate(),112) 结果:20031228select convert(char(8),getdate(),108)结果:16:52:00select con...

2008-01-29 15:20:51 373

几种数据库的语法的对比(整理中)

  序号简述Access语法 SqlServer语法 Oracle语法DB2语法解决方案01系统时间Date() GETDATE() SYSDATE  GetSysTimeStr02连接字符串& + || + GetConcatStr 03截取字符串 SubString SubStr SubStringSubStringGetSubStr 04小写字符串LCaseLowerLowerLow...

2008-01-29 15:16:05 718

MyEclipse6.0(Eclipse3.3)的插件---(编辑中)

MyEclipse6.0装Vss插件(用Linked方式),要用 org.vssplugin_1.6.2 版本;MyEclipse5.5装Vss插件,要用 org.vssplugin_1.6.1 版本;

2008-01-29 15:05:27 84

原创 SQLserver中用convert函数转换日期格式

SQLserver中用convert函数转换日期格式 select getdate()结果:2003-12-28 16:52:00.107 select convert(char(8),getdate(),112) 结果:20031228

2007-06-28 14:13:00 931

原创 几种数据库语法的对比(不全)

一、有区别的函数及解决方案 以下所示的解决方案中的函数定义在untDataBase单元中TAdoConn类的方法中。  序号 简述 Access语法 SqlServer语法 Oracle语法 D

2007-06-28 11:13:00 1118

原创 ANT构建后,用IDE进行断点调试

ANT构建后,用IDE进行断点调试 1、如题,在ant的javac后面加:debug="on",然后用IDE启动服务器,设置断点就可以进行断点调试了,此外还可以进行热部署;2、设置服务器进行远程调试,比如Jboss,编辑run.bat,rem 远程调试设置(rem 是相当于注释)set JAVA_OPTS=-Xdebug -Xrunjdwp:transport=dt_socket,ad

2007-06-27 16:42:00 1603

原创 Jboss配置Oracle数据库连接池

Jboss配置Oracle数据库连接池     这两天在做把系统从 weblogic+oracle 转移到 Jboss+sqlServer上;     之前一点都不熟悉Jboss和EJB,所以只有一点点来了。     开发的IDE是Eclipse,一开始要做的就是:自己建一个小的EJB的J2EE应用,部署到Jboss服务器上去,然后进行访问。先理解是怎么一回事,这样对于后面的项目系统中

2007-06-12 17:50:00 4672

原创 CMP开发过程中的datasourcemapping设置

CMP开发过程中的datasourcemapping设置  在用工具进行开发过程中我们可能对一些基本的问题存在疑惑,这也可能导致一个初学者对一项新技术的疏远,这里对CMP开发过程中的datasourcemapping选项做一点解释如下:关于datasourcemapping选项的设置涉及的文件有:   xdoclet.xml   standardjbosscmp-jdbc.xml   *-

2007-06-12 13:50:00 886

原创 为什么要使用EJB?(转载)

为什么要使用EJB?(转载)init_Nav();  首先,我们必须明确,为什么要使用J2EE?J2EE优点是什么?使用J2EE的主要原因是多层结构,传统的两层C/S结构难于维护,稳定性极差,界面代码和数据库代码混淆在一起,牵一动百,多层结构使得界面和数据库完全分离,并且诞生了中间件这样的技术。  Web+EJB能组成真正的多层结构  为什么使用EJB我原先

2007-06-12 13:44:00 1484 1

原创 HQL 语言基本用法

HQL 语言基本用法1.实体查询String hql = " from TUser";执行这条语句会返回TUser以及TUser子类的纪录。hql = "from java.lang.Object"会返回数据库中所有库表的纪录。where 语句hql = "from TUser as user where user.name=yyy";其中,as可以省略也一样hql = "fr

2007-06-12 10:50:00 719

原创 Eclipse及其插件介绍和下载 (转载)

Eclipse及其插件介绍和下载   0.Eclipse下载EMF,GEF - Graphical Editor Framework,UM

2007-06-11 18:20:00 756

原创 struts常见异常整理

struts常见异常整理 struts常见异常整理javax.servlet.jsp.JspException: Cannot retrieve mapping for action /Login (/Login是你的action名字)    可能原因

2007-06-11 13:53:00 1267

原创 JBossIDE Eclispe 开发EJB2.1实例

JBossIDE Eclispe 开发EJB2.1实例(转载)EJB2.1开发实例1.环境配置1)JDK1.5 文件名:jdk-1_5_0_05-windows-i586-p.exe下载地址:https://jsecom16k.sun.com/ECom/EComActionServlet;jsessionid=31A76905496B86DCF9BCFE1CAC

2007-06-08 15:44:00 1168

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除